Tax Shield Approach
A financial strategy that utilizes deductible expenses, like interest, to reduce a company's taxable income, thereby lowering its tax liability.
Operating Cash Flow
The cash generated from a company's normal business operations, indicating its ability to generate positive cash flow.
CCA Class
A classification system used in Canadian tax law for capital cost allowance, determining the depreciation rate for tax purposes of tangible capital assets.
